WordTips is your source for cost-effective Microsoft Word training. (Microsoft Word is the most popular word processing software in the world.) This tip (92) applies to Microsoft Word 97, 2000, 2002, and 2003. You can find a version of this tip for the ribbon interface of Word (Word 2007 and later) here: Sequentially Numbering Elements in Your Document.
(function(){"use strict";function u(e){return"function"==typeof e||"object"==typeof e&&null!==e}function s(e){return"function"==typeof e}function a(e){X=e}function l(e){G=e}function c(){return function(){r.nextTick(p)}}function f(){var e=0,n=new ne(p),t=document.createTextNode("");return n.observe(t,{characterData:!0}),function(){t.data=e=++e%2}}function d(){var e=new MessageChannel;return e.port1.onmessage=p,function(){e.port2.postMessage(0)}}function h(){return function(){setTimeout(p,1)}}function p(){for(var e=0;et.length)&&(n=t.length),n-=e.length;var r=t.indexOf(e,n);return-1!==r&&r===n}),String.prototype.startsWith||(String.prototype.startsWith=function(e,n){return n=n||0,this.substr(n,e.length)===e}),String.prototype.trim||(String.prototype.trim=function(){return this.replace(/^[\s\uFEFF\xA0]+|[\s\uFEFF\xA0]+$/g,"")}),String.prototype.includes||(String.prototype.includes=function(e,n){"use strict";return"number"!=typeof n&&(n=0),!(n+e.length>this.length)&&-1!==this.indexOf(e,n)})},"./shared/require-global.js":function(e,n,t){e.exports=t("./shared/require-shim.js")},"./shared/require-shim.js":function(e,n,t){var r=t("./shared/errors.js"),i=(this.window,!1),o=null,u=null,s=new Promise(function(e,n){o=e,u=n}),a=function(e){if(!a.hasModule(e)){var n=new Error('Cannot find module "'+e+'"');throw n.code="MODULE_NOT_FOUND",n}return t("./"+e+".js")};a.loadChunk=function(e){return s.then(function(){return"main"==e?t.e("main").then(function(e){t("./main.js")}.bind(null,t))["catch"](t.oe):"dev"==e?Promise.all([t.e("main"),t.e("dev")]).then(function(e){t("./shared/dev.js")}.bind(null,t))["catch"](t.oe):"internal"==e?Promise.all([t.e("main"),t.e("internal"),t.e("qtext2"),t.e("dev")]).then(function(e){t("./internal.js")}.bind(null,t))["catch"](t.oe):"ads_manager"==e?Promise.all([t.e("main"),t.e("ads_manager")]).then(function(e){und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ined}.bind(null,t))["catch"](t.oe):"publisher_dashboard"==e?t.e("publisher_dashboard").then(function(e){undefined,undefined,undefined,undefined,undefined,undefined,undefined,undefined}.bind(null,t))["catch"](t.oe):"content_widgets"==e?Promise.all([t.e("main"),t.e("content_widgets")]).then(function(e){t("./content_widgets.iframe.js")}.bind(null,t))["catch"](t.oe):void 0})},a.whenReady=function(e,n){Promise.all(window.webpackChunks.map(function(e){return a.loadChunk(e)})).then(function(){n()})},a.installPageProperties=function(e,n){window.Q.settings=e,window.Q.gating=n,i=!0,o()},a.assertPagePropertiesInstalled=function(){i||(u(),r.logJsError("installPageProperties","The install page properties promise was rejected in require-shim."))},a.prefetchAll=function(){t("./settings.js");Promise.all([t.e("main"),t.e("qtext2")]).then(function(){}.bind(null,t))["catch"](t.oe)},a.hasModule=function(e){return!!window.NODE_JS||t.m.hasOwnProperty("./"+e+".js")},a.execAll=function(){var e=Object.keys(t.m);try{for(var n=0;n=c?n():document.fonts.load(l(o,'"'+o.family+'"'),s).then(function(n){1<=n.length?e():setTimeout(t,25)},function(){n()})}t()});var w=new Promise(function(e,n){a=setTimeout(n,c)});Promise.race([w,m]).then(function(){clearTimeout(a),e(o)},function(){n(o)})}else t(function(){function t(){var n;(n=-1!=y&&-1!=g||-1!=y&&-1!=v||-1!=g&&-1!=v)&&((n=y!=g&&y!=v&&g!=v)||(null===f&&(n=/AppleWebKit\/([0-9]+)(?:\.([0-9]+))/.exec(window.navigator.userAgent),f=!!n&&(536>parseInt(n[1],10)||536===parseInt(n[1],10)&&11>=parseInt(n[2],10))),n=f&&(y==b&&g==b&&v==b||y==x&&g==x&&v==x||y==j&&g==j&&v==j)),n=!n),n&&(null!==_.parentNode&&_.parentNode.removeChild(_),clearTimeout(a),e(o))}function d(){if((new Date).getTime()-h>=c)null!==_.parentNode&&_.parentNode.removeChild(_),n(o);else{var e=document.hidden;!0!==e&&void 0!==e||(y=p.a.offsetWidth,g=m.a.offsetWidth,v=w.a.offsetWidth,t()),a=setTimeout(d,50)}}var p=new r(s),m=new r(s),w=new r(s),y=-1,g=-1,v=-1,b=-1,x=-1,j=-1,_=document.createElement("div");_.dir="ltr",i(p,l(o,"sans-serif")),i(m,l(o,"serif")),i(w,l(o,"monospace")),_.appendChild(p.a),_.appendChild(m.a),_.appendChild(w.a),document.body.appendChild(_),b=p.a.offsetWidth,x=m.a.offsetWidth,j=w.a.offsetWidth,d(),u(p,function(e){y=e,t()}),i(p,l(o,'"'+o.family+'",sans-serif')),u(m,function(e){g=e,t()}),i(m,l(o,'"'+o.family+'",serif')),u(w,function(e){v=e,t()}),i(w,l(o,'"'+o.family+'",monospace'))})})},void 0!==e?e.exports=s:(window.FontFaceObserver=s,window.FontFaceObserver.prototype.load=s.prototype.load)}()},"./third_party/tracekit.js":function(e,n){/**

Please guide me that i have Purchase order in one excel sheet i.e 200 pages i want to know any formula for footer page number which should be permanent Means i have 1st purchase order of 3 pages, 2nd purchase order for 4 pages and 3rd purchase order for 2 pages. each purchase order has different Serial number but all in one excel sheet i.e sheet1. i inserted footer page no of ? which generate 1 of 9, 2 of 9 etc. Please guide i want to segerate the footer page number for 1st page order 1 of 3, 2 of 3 and 3 of 3. 2nd purchase order should have footer page number 1 of 4, 2 of 4 etc and hence for 3rd purchase order. looking forward for your guidance
you'd need to use a before save macro. Something like the macro at the end - but it would run on every save, which may not be what you want. I use a macro that gets the invoice # and saves (it does several things). I added a button to the ribbon that calls a macro that runs several macros: Sub FinalizeInvoice() CreateInvoiceNumber CopyToExcel FinalCleanup ' this does the save End Sub This is an automated macro - but it will run every time the file is saved. Private WithEvents App As Word.Application Private Sub Document_Open() Set App = Word.Application… Read more »
In this system, the third number (instead of the second) denotes a minor release, and a fourth number (instead of the third) denotes bug-fix/revision releases.[23] Because the first number is always 10, and because the subsequent numbers are not decimal, but integer values, the 11th major version of OS X is labeled “10.10” (rather than 11.0). This number scheme continues above point-10, with Apple releasing macOS 10.13 in 2017.[24]
In summary, paragraph numbering is really just an exercise in logic, and this blog post is showing the numbering styles for a very specific project. Your project may be similar, but not exactly the same. You just need to think though the levels and how you want to restart the numbers. I do my best to think it through correctly the first time, set it up, and then try as hard as I can to break it, so that I can find my errors. The good news is that once you get your numbers working, you shouldn’t ever have to think about it again.

Set up a matrix in Excel, one column for each ticket position (stack) and one row for each sheet, plus one for field names. Fill the first column down in consecutive order, then the second, starting where the first column leaves off, and so on. Afet a couple of columns are filled, you can auto fill across the rows, too, so the whole thing takes only a couple of minutes. Name the stacks and use a different field for each position on the page when you do the merge. The trick is to set up using a custom file for the total number of tickets or whatever, divided into the correct number of stacks and sheets.
If you start to type in what appears to be a numbered list, Word formats your manually typed "numbers" to an automatic numbered list. The main benefit of this option is that you do not need to click any button to start numbering and you can choose your numbering style as well. For example, if you type "(a) some text" and press Enter, it starts numbering using the "(a)" format.
you'd need to use a before save macro. Something like the macro at the end - but it would run on every save, which may not be what you want. I use a macro that gets the invoice # and saves (it does several things). I added a button to the ribbon that calls a macro that runs several macros: Sub FinalizeInvoice() CreateInvoiceNumber CopyToExcel FinalCleanup ' this does the save End Sub This is an automated macro - but it will run every time the file is saved. Private WithEvents App As Word.Application Private Sub Document_Open() Set App = Word.Application… Read more »

Auto-Number is a very easy to use software program developed by a printer (35+ years in the industry) to eliminate manual or letterpress numbering. The program will print up to sixteen numbers in any location, increment and duplicate. No Experience Necessary! Any person with basic computer skills is able to master this software within minutes. We’ve included set-up templates for the most common jobs. Use as is or modify them to your specs.
One solution is to format the heading with the style and follow it with a hidden paragraph mark. You should format the text in the next paragraph with a style that is not included in the Table of Contents. A hidden paragraph mark keeps the text together on one line when it is printed, even though it is actually two separate paragraphs. The Table of Contents command picks up only those paragraphs with heading styles and places them into the Table of Contents.
Regarding exporting to EPUB, I have very limited experience in that department! I understood that InDesign compiles the EPUB using text and image frames in the order they appear in the document? So that chapter 2 would naturally follow chapter 1, and so on? If each chapter is in a separate document and all chapters are linked together using the Book feature, I think you can export to EPUB in a similar way that you can export to PDF?
Numbers has been well received in the press, notably for its text-based formulas, clean looks and ease-of-use.[17][18][19] Macworld has given it high marks, especially newer versions, awarding Numbers ’09 four mice out of five. They did point out a number of common issues, especially problems exporting to Excel and the inability to “lock” cells to prevent them moving when the table is scrolled.[14] Numbers for the iPhone and iPad have received similar favorable reviews.[20]

By default, bullets and numbers inherit some of their text formatting from the first character in the paragraph to which they’re attached. If the first character in one paragraph is different from the first characters in other paragraphs, the numbering or bullet character may appear inconsistent with the other list items. If this is not the formatting you desire, create a character style for numbers or bullets and apply it to your list by using the Bullets And Numbering dialog box.


A multi-level list is a list that describes hierarchical relationships between the list paragraphs. These lists are also called outline lists because they resemble outlines. The list’s numbering scheme (as well as indentations) show rank as well as how items are subordinate to one another. You can tell where each paragraph fits in the list with respect to the paragraphs before and after it. You can include up to nine levels in a multi-level list.

Hello! I would like to chart varying salaries against specific Low, middle and high numbers. Any suggestions on how to show this? Example: Salary 1 10000 Salary 2 12000 Salary 3 16000 Low 9000 Mid 15000 High 19000 THANK YOU! Do you want the Low-Mid-High values to be like a benchmark to measure salaries against? You could put horizontal lines across your chart, and use markers for the salary data. Here' a few ways to get your lines: http://peltiertech.com/Excel/Charts/AddLine.html - Jon ------- Jon Peltier, Microsoft Excel MVP Peltier Technical Services Tutorials...

So if you encountered this problem, then you didn’t follow the instructions completely (which is OK) and appear to be automatically generating the number whenever the record is accessed. If that’s the case, then you are risking duplication because you are not saving the generated number immediately. Rather then try to test if a number already exists as you seem to be doing, you should not automatically generate the number, but trigger the generation from some action in the form.

!function(e){function n(t){if(r[t])return r[t].exports;var i=r[t]={i:t,l:!1,exports:{}};return e[t].call(i.exports,i,i.exports,n),i.l=!0,i.exports}var t=window.webpackJsonp;window.webpackJsonp=function(n,r,o){for(var u,s,a=0,l=[];a1)for(var t=1;td)return!1;if(p>f)return!1;var e=window.require.hasModule("shared/browser")&&window.require("shared/browser");return!e||!e.opera}function s(){var e="";return"quora.com"==window.Q.subdomainSuffix&&(e+=[window.location.protocol,"//log.quora.com"].join("")),e+="/ajax/log_errors_3RD_PARTY_POST"}function a(){var e=o(h);h=[],0!==e.length&&c(s(),{revision:window.Q.revision,errors:JSON.stringify(e)})}var l=t("./third_party/tracekit.js"),c=t("./shared/basicrpc.js").rpc;l.remoteFetching=!1,l.collectWindowErrors=!0,l.report.subscribe(r);var f=10,d=window.Q&&window.Q.errorSamplingRate||1,h=[],p=0,m=i(a,1e3),w=window.console&&!(window.NODE_JS&&window.UNIT_TEST);n.report=function(e){try{w&&console.error(e.stack||e),l.report(e)}catch(e){}};var y=function(e,n,t){r({name:n,message:t,source:e,stack:l.computeStackTrace.ofCaller().stack||[]}),w&&console.error(t)};n.logJsError=y.bind(null,"js"),n.logMobileJsError=y.bind(null,"mobile_js")},"./shared/globals.js":function(e,n,t){var r=t("./shared/links.js");(window.Q=window.Q||{}).openUrl=function(e,n){var t=e.href;return r.linkClicked(t,n),window.open(t).opener=null,!1}},"./shared/links.js":function(e,n){var t=[];n.onLinkClick=function(e){t.push(e)},n.linkClicked=function(e,n){for(var r=0;r>>0;if("function"!=typeof e)throw new TypeError;for(arguments.length>1&&(t=n),r=0;r>>0,r=arguments.length>=2?arguments[1]:void 0,i=0;i>>0;if(0===i)return-1;var o=+n||0;if(Math.abs(o)===Infinity&&(o=0),o>=i)return-1;for(t=Math.max(o>=0?o:i-Math.abs(o),0);t>>0;if("function"!=typeof e)throw new TypeError(e+" is not a function");for(arguments.length>1&&(t=n),r=0;r>>0;if("function"!=typeof e)throw new TypeError(e+" is not a function");for(arguments.length>1&&(t=n),r=new Array(u),i=0;i>>0;if("function"!=typeof e)throw new TypeError;for(var r=[],i=arguments.length>=2?arguments[1]:void 0,o=0;o>>0,i=0;if(2==arguments.length)n=arguments[1];else{for(;i=r)throw new TypeError("Reduce of empty array with no initial value");n=t[i++]}for(;i>>0;if(0===i)return-1;for(n=i-1,arguments.length>1&&(n=Number(arguments[1]),n!=n?n=0:0!==n&&n!=1/0&&n!=-1/0&&(n=(n>0||-1)*Math.floor(Math.abs(n)))),t=n>=0?Math.min(n,i-1):i-Math.abs(n);t>=0;t--)if(t in r&&r[t]===e)return t;return-1};t(Array.prototype,"lastIndexOf",c)}if(!Array.prototype.includes){var f=function(e){"use strict";if(null==this)throw new TypeError("Array.prototype.includes called on null or undefined");var n=Object(this),t=parseInt(n.length,10)||0;if(0===t)return!1;var r,i=parseInt(arguments[1],10)||0;i>=0?r=i:(r=t+i)<0&&(r=0);for(var o;r
The Wine project formerly used a date versioning scheme, which uses the year followed by the month followed by the day of the release; for example, “Wine 20040505”. Ubuntu Linux uses a similar versioning scheme—Ubuntu 11.10, for example, was released October 2011. Some video games also use date as versioning, for example the arcade game Street Fighter EX. At startup it displays the version number as a date plus a region code, for example 961219 ASIA.
Hi, As a new user to excel I am thinking of setting up a data base of my music. The total number of tracks is in excess of 70,000. I have seen a simple solution using excel which would be ok but I'm not sure if I can have 70,000 rows in one work sheet. A friend has suggested access which I am not familiar with and don't know if this will allow 70,000 entries. Can anyone please tell me what the maximum numbers are in both access and excel 2003. Cheers Glinty Max in Excel 2003 is 65536 (in one sheet) whereas Access only limit is your memory -- Regards, Peo Sjoblom ... sequentially numbering in indesign
×